[0022] A method to improve the efficiency of the baffled anaerobic reactor. The effluent treated by the baffled anaerobic reactor first enters the sump, part of the wastewater in the sump enters the aerobic aeration tank of the next processing unit, and part of the wastewater passes through the pump Control, the inlet of the baffled anaerobic reactor enters the baffled anaerobic reactor again to form a reflux; the flow of wastewater returning from the sump to the baffled anaerobic reactor accounts for 30% of the flow of wastewater entering the baffled anaerobic reactor ~100%.
[0023] The effective volume of the sump is 1 / 100 to 8 / 100 of the effective volume of the baffled anaerobic reactor, that is, the volume of the sump can store the output of the baffled anaerobic reactor for 6 to 20 minutes. Water volume.
